Requirements

  • Expert Knowledge of computer assisted design and drafting (CADD) 3D and 4D software and practices.
  • Expert Knowledge of engineer principles of design.
  • Expert Knowledge of Microsoft business software (excel, word, etc.).
  • Excellent verbal and written communications skills.
  • Strong knowledge of federal, state and local regulations.
  • Bachelor's degree in Civil, Transportation, or Structural Engineering or related discipline.
  • Certification as an Engineer in Training (EIT) or passing the Fundamentals of Engineering (FE) exam in states where an EIT is not obtainable (within 18 months of hire or promotion or transfer).
  • 5 years of related experience.
  • Domestic and/or international travel may be required.
  • Equivalent additional directly related experience will be considered in lieu of a degree.

Nice To Haves

  • Basic knowledge of design standards (AASHTO, NACTO, etc.).
